Whitney Houston Tribute Brings On Tears; 2012 BET Awards Winners + Photos
The 2012 BET Awards red carpet was host to everything from hip-hop and R&B stars to a host of actors and actresses including Nicki Minaj, Beyonce, Mariah Carey, MC Lyte, Yolonda Adams, Faith Evans, Kerry Washington, Taraji P. Henson, Brandy, Chaka Khan, Melanie Fiona, Cissy Houston, Monica, Willow, amongst others.
The BET Awards most heartrending moment was the tribute to Whitney Houston which included an opening tribute speech by Mariah Carery that was followed with a performance by Monica who sang one of Whitney Houston’s favorite gospel tunes, “I Love the Lord.”
R&B singer Monica was followed by Brandy who did a great performance of Whitney’s hits, “I Wanna Dance With Somebody” and “I’m Your Baby Tonight” which led into Whitney Houston’s brother Gary Houston singing. Whitney Houston’s brother was followed by their mother Cissy Houston who sung the song “Bridge Over Troubled Water” which touched numerous people in the audience who began shedding tears which included Beyonce as well as hip-hop artist Soulja Boy who was accompanied by female rapper Diamond.
The tribute to Whitney Houston would not have been complete without Chaka Khan who sang the song “I’m Every Woman” remade by Houston, as well as words from her cast-mates from the hit movie “Waiting to Exhale” – Angela Bassett, Lela Rochon and Loretta Devine who spoke highly of the singer.
As for the award winners at the BET Awards 2012, it included:
Best Female R&B Artist
Beyoncé
Best Female Hip-Hop Artist
Nicki Minaj
Best Gospel
Yolanda Adams
Lifetime Achievement Award
Maze, featuring Frankie Beverly
Video of the Year
The Throne (Jay-Z and Kanye West), featuring Otis Redding, “Otis”
Humanitarian Award
The Reverend Al Sharpton
Viewers’ Choice Award
Mindless Behavior
Video Director of the Year
Beyoncé and Alan Ferguson
Entertainer of the Year
Chris Brown
Centric Award
Common
Youngstars Award
Diggy
Best Group
The Throne (Jay-Z and Kanye West)
Best Actor
Kevin Hart, “Think Like a Man”
Best New Artist
Big Sean
Best Male R&B Artist
Chris Brown
Best Collaboration
Wale (featuring Miguel), “Lotus Flower Bomb”
